The first facet of this strategy involves mastering the art of client retention. Retaining clients is not just a matter of providing effective workouts; it’s about creating an experience that goes beyond the gym floor. Establishing a strong rapport, understanding individual goals, and tailoring sessions accordingly are the building blocks of client loyalty. When clients feel a genuine connection, they are more likely to commit long-term, forming the foundation of a lucrative financial relationship.

Furthermore, trainers can amplify their earnings by strategically offering additional services and high-ticket fitness packages. Rather than viewing each session in isolation, savvy trainers recognize the potential for upselling premium packages that cater to a client’s specific needs and aspirations. These packages may include personalized nutrition plans, advanced training sessions, or even exclusive access to specialized fitness events. By presenting these options as valuable investments in the client’s well-being, trainers can not only enhance the overall experience but also boost their bottom line.

Beyond the immediate upsell opportunities, trainers can tap into the power of ongoing client engagement. Regular check-ins, progress assessments, and continuous communication outside of scheduled sessions create a sense of personalized attention that resonates with clients. In an era where personalization is valued more than ever, these efforts contribute to client satisfaction and, consequently, prolonged commitment.

One often-overlooked avenue for financial growth is the potential for digital offerings. With the prevalence of virtual fitness platforms, trainers can extend their reach beyond the confines of a physical gym. Online training sessions, custom workout plans, and virtual coaching open up new revenue streams while accommodating clients who seek flexibility in their fitness routines. This diversification not only caters to the evolving landscape of fitness preferences but also positions trainers at the forefront of industry trends.

In the pursuit of financial success, trainers should also leverage the power of testimonials and success stories. A satisfied client becomes a brand advocate, indirectly marketing the trainer’s services to their network. Positive word-of-mouth can be a potent force in attracting new clients and retaining existing ones. Trainers should actively seek feedback, showcase client transformations, and use these narratives to reinforce their value proposition.

Additionally, fostering a sense of community among clients can further solidify their commitment. Group workouts, fitness challenges, and social events create a camaraderie that transcends the trainer-client relationship. As clients bond over shared fitness goals, trainers become not just instructors but facilitators of a collective journey. This community-driven approach not only enhances the overall client experience but also fortifies the trainer’s position as an integral part of their fitness journey.
